annotate ChangeLog @ 91:cb6c6de125dc

halfway
author Atuto SHIROMA <e095729@ie.u-ryukyu.ac.jp>
date Thu, 26 May 2011 14:44:03 +0900
parents ce9ef7dcf2f0
children 8ac08eda80ac
Ignore whitespace changes - Everywhere: Within whitespace: At end of lines:
rev   line source
83
22821fc0dddb *** empty log message ***
gongo
parents: 62
diff changeset
1 2006-11-10 Wataru MIYAGUNI <gongo@cr.ie.u-ryukyu.ac.jp>
22821fc0dddb *** empty log message ***
gongo
parents: 62
diff changeset
2
22821fc0dddb *** empty log message ***
gongo
parents: 62
diff changeset
3 * linda.c:linda_set_schedule
88
ce9ef7dcf2f0 convert UTF-8
Shinji KONO <kono@ie.u-ryukyu.ac.jp>
parents: 83
diff changeset
4 psx_inとpsx_outを同時にしてはいけないらしいので
ce9ef7dcf2f0 convert UTF-8
Shinji KONO <kono@ie.u-ryukyu.ac.jp>
parents: 83
diff changeset
5 最初にinをして、データが無くなったのを確認できたら
ce9ef7dcf2f0 convert UTF-8
Shinji KONO <kono@ie.u-ryukyu.ac.jp>
parents: 83
diff changeset
6 send_packetを行う。ただ、send_packetをしない場合は
ce9ef7dcf2f0 convert UTF-8
Shinji KONO <kono@ie.u-ryukyu.ac.jp>
parents: 83
diff changeset
7 scheduleも変わらないようにしないといけないので
ce9ef7dcf2f0 convert UTF-8
Shinji KONO <kono@ie.u-ryukyu.ac.jp>
parents: 83
diff changeset
8 返り値で判断しようかと考え中だが
ce9ef7dcf2f0 convert UTF-8
Shinji KONO <kono@ie.u-ryukyu.ac.jp>
parents: 83
diff changeset
9 Boolでやって以下書いたコード全部if文書くのは
ce9ef7dcf2f0 convert UTF-8
Shinji KONO <kono@ie.u-ryukyu.ac.jp>
parents: 83
diff changeset
10 めんどくさいよ〜。でもやらないとだが。でも眠い(現在28時
83
22821fc0dddb *** empty log message ***
gongo
parents: 62
diff changeset
11
22821fc0dddb *** empty log message ***
gongo
parents: 62
diff changeset
12
62
d71fbefaa9a9 *** empty log message ***
gongo
parents: 57
diff changeset
13 2006-11-09 <j03056@mammaaiuto.cr.ie.u-ryukyu.ac.jp>
d71fbefaa9a9 *** empty log message ***
gongo
parents: 57
diff changeset
14
d71fbefaa9a9 *** empty log message ***
gongo
parents: 57
diff changeset
15 * xml.c
d71fbefaa9a9 *** empty log message ***
gongo
parents: 57
diff changeset
16 <wrn><malloc>not found malloc-shelf has specified addr(~), in
d71fbefaa9a9 *** empty log message ***
gongo
parents: 57
diff changeset
17 xml.c at xml_free, ;ine 238
88
ce9ef7dcf2f0 convert UTF-8
Shinji KONO <kono@ie.u-ryukyu.ac.jp>
parents: 83
diff changeset
18 見つけたバグ。てか前からあるんだよなこのライブラリのバグ
ce9ef7dcf2f0 convert UTF-8
Shinji KONO <kono@ie.u-ryukyu.ac.jp>
parents: 83
diff changeset
19 いずれ直すってことで記録
62
d71fbefaa9a9 *** empty log message ***
gongo
parents: 57
diff changeset
20
57
dfe6a2fb031a *** empty log message ***
gongo
parents:
diff changeset
21 2006-11-08 Wataru MIYAGUNI <gongo@cr.ie.u-ryukyu.ac.jp>
dfe6a2fb031a *** empty log message ***
gongo
parents:
diff changeset
22
dfe6a2fb031a *** empty log message ***
gongo
parents:
diff changeset
23 * linda.c: get_packet
88
ce9ef7dcf2f0 convert UTF-8
Shinji KONO <kono@ie.u-ryukyu.ac.jp>
parents: 83
diff changeset
24 相手の車の位置情報を上手く取得できない。
ce9ef7dcf2f0 convert UTF-8
Shinji KONO <kono@ie.u-ryukyu.ac.jp>
parents: 83
diff changeset
25 と思ったらmemcpyでできました。何をやってたんだ俺は。
57
dfe6a2fb031a *** empty log message ***
gongo
parents:
diff changeset
26
88
ce9ef7dcf2f0 convert UTF-8
Shinji KONO <kono@ie.u-ryukyu.ac.jp>
parents: 83
diff changeset
27 いろいろ他にかえましたが、記録し忘れで
ce9ef7dcf2f0 convert UTF-8
Shinji KONO <kono@ie.u-ryukyu.ac.jp>
parents: 83
diff changeset
28 何やったのか・・・今度から気をつけます。
57
dfe6a2fb031a *** empty log message ***
gongo
parents:
diff changeset
29
dfe6a2fb031a *** empty log message ***
gongo
parents:
diff changeset
30 * TODO:
88
ce9ef7dcf2f0 convert UTF-8
Shinji KONO <kono@ie.u-ryukyu.ac.jp>
parents: 83
diff changeset
31 *通信を完成させる
ce9ef7dcf2f0 convert UTF-8
Shinji KONO <kono@ie.u-ryukyu.ac.jp>
parents: 83
diff changeset
32 *linda.cは、schedule.cみたいに
ce9ef7dcf2f0 convert UTF-8
Shinji KONO <kono@ie.u-ryukyu.ac.jp>
parents: 83
diff changeset
33 関数で状態を把握してるのだが
ce9ef7dcf2f0 convert UTF-8
Shinji KONO <kono@ie.u-ryukyu.ac.jp>
parents: 83
diff changeset
34 おかげでにたような処理をしている関数が多数。
ce9ef7dcf2f0 convert UTF-8
Shinji KONO <kono@ie.u-ryukyu.ac.jp>
parents: 83
diff changeset
35 これを合併させようとすると結局前と一緒になってしまう。
ce9ef7dcf2f0 convert UTF-8
Shinji KONO <kono@ie.u-ryukyu.ac.jp>
parents: 83
diff changeset
36 というわけで良き案がでるまでこれで保留。
57
dfe6a2fb031a *** empty log message ***
gongo
parents:
diff changeset
37
88
ce9ef7dcf2f0 convert UTF-8
Shinji KONO <kono@ie.u-ryukyu.ac.jp>
parents: 83
diff changeset
38 とりあえずtag情報
57
dfe6a2fb031a *** empty log message ***
gongo
parents:
diff changeset
39
dfe6a2fb031a *** empty log message ***
gongo
parents:
diff changeset
40 release1 :
88
ce9ef7dcf2f0 convert UTF-8
Shinji KONO <kono@ie.u-ryukyu.ac.jp>
parents: 83
diff changeset
41 前期ゲーム班が完成させた状態。
ce9ef7dcf2f0 convert UTF-8
Shinji KONO <kono@ie.u-ryukyu.ac.jp>
parents: 83
diff changeset
42 動くが、1レース終了ごとにほぼ落ちる。
ce9ef7dcf2f0 convert UTF-8
Shinji KONO <kono@ie.u-ryukyu.ac.jp>
parents: 83
diff changeset
43 1レースするまでもなく、コースの途中まで行き、
ce9ef7dcf2f0 convert UTF-8
Shinji KONO <kono@ie.u-ryukyu.ac.jp>
parents: 83
diff changeset
44 ポーズ画面からレース終了でも落ちることあり。
ce9ef7dcf2f0 convert UTF-8
Shinji KONO <kono@ie.u-ryukyu.ac.jp>
parents: 83
diff changeset
45 >コースの途中まで
ce9ef7dcf2f0 convert UTF-8
Shinji KONO <kono@ie.u-ryukyu.ac.jp>
parents: 83
diff changeset
46 ここが落ちる原因を探すヒントっぽいっていうか
ce9ef7dcf2f0 convert UTF-8
Shinji KONO <kono@ie.u-ryukyu.ac.jp>
parents: 83
diff changeset
47 いつも同じコースをfree()するときにおちるので
ce9ef7dcf2f0 convert UTF-8
Shinji KONO <kono@ie.u-ryukyu.ac.jp>
parents: 83
diff changeset
48 そこが怪しいと思いつつわけわからん
ce9ef7dcf2f0 convert UTF-8
Shinji KONO <kono@ie.u-ryukyu.ac.jp>
parents: 83
diff changeset
49 俺としては単にポリゴンが多いからと予想。
57
dfe6a2fb031a *** empty log message ***
gongo
parents:
diff changeset
50
dfe6a2fb031a *** empty log message ***
gongo
parents:
diff changeset
51 release1-1:
88
ce9ef7dcf2f0 convert UTF-8
Shinji KONO <kono@ie.u-ryukyu.ac.jp>
parents: 83
diff changeset
52 俺が書き直したやつ。状態遷移変数を抜いたver。
ce9ef7dcf2f0 convert UTF-8
Shinji KONO <kono@ie.u-ryukyu.ac.jp>
parents: 83
diff changeset
53 どうやって判断するかってのは、関数ポインタで
ce9ef7dcf2f0 convert UTF-8
Shinji KONO <kono@ie.u-ryukyu.ac.jp>
parents: 83
diff changeset
54 ジャンプしまくりです。CbCっぽいってーかCbCでかけよ俺。